The properties of virtual passive controllers, i.e., active vibration absorbers, and of the closed-loop systems achievable by means of such compensation are analyzed. It is shown that these controllers introduce additional transmission zeros into the closed-loop system. Therefore, they provide an extra degree of design freedom over that provided by state feedback, which cannot alter the zeros in any way.
